As quantum ‘Q-Day’ jumps to 2029, Ethereum faces a new fight over what to do with coins left in old wallets
Summary
The realistic quantum threat to Ethereum, or "Q-Day," is now framed around a 2029 horizon, according to Google's planning, accelerating the need for post-quantum readiness. The Ethereum Foundation's roadmap prioritizes migrating exposed surfaces, starting with user accounts (EOAs), then high-value operational keys at exchanges and bridges, followed by governance multisigs and validator keys. Account abstraction (EIP-4337) is the primary execution-layer path for users to upgrade authentication without a chain reset, though adoption is still partial. The coordination challenge is significant, especially for bridges and custodians holding billions in value, where operational discipline is already lacking. Furthermore, the community faces a politically charged decision regarding dormant coins whose public keys were exposed in old transactions; the EF suggests outcomes are either doing nothing or freezing vulnerable coins, estimating Ethereum's exposure at only 0.1% of supply, compared to Bitcoin's higher risk. The industry is already pricing in operational lag as a security risk, meaning credible migration timelines are becoming essential for capital retention well before a cryptographically relevant quantum computer arrives.
